Title: Re: Zener Diode Model in HSpice Post by linker on Aug 16th, 2010, 11:38pm MODEL DZ IS=80.21637E-9 N=2.80334 RS=3.412605e-002 CJO=135E-12 M=.5033 VJ=.75 + ISR=4.2604E-6 NR=4.11012 BV=6.2 IBV=49.004E-3 TT=150.49E-9 COMMENTS:please notice to this comments ISR IS the minimum current of zener diode IBV is the maximum current of the zener diode BV Is the break voltage of zener diode |

BTW: ISR is the reverse saturation current (at TNOM) IBV is current at V = -BV BV is the breakdown voltage Note that one can have funny issues when computing I at V=-BV from I(v) = IS * (exp(v/(N*vt)) -1) + ISR * (exp((v+BV)/(NR*vt)) - 1) + GMIN * v and comparing that to IBV. Of course, I(v) should be continuous, so it seems to me that IBV is overconstraining the system, and maybe is just approximate. |
